Australia's Parliament recently reconvened with a notable focus on the Gaza conflict. Pro-Palestine demonstrations and demands for sanctions against Israel marked the return of lawmakers.

These events coincided with Governor-General Sam Mostyn's opening address. Protesters were active both inside and outside Parliament House, many being detained while voicing their concerns.

A striking moment occurred when Senator Mehreen Faruqi directly asked Prime Minister Anthony Albanese to "Sanction Israel," highlighting the dire humanitarian situation in Gaza. This underscored the growing pressure on the government.

Australia has already joined 25 other nations in a joint statement urging an immediate halt to Israeli attacks and condemning the obstruction of humanitarian aid. This reflects a significant international stance.

The calls for action stem from the devastating situation in Gaza, where a high number of Palestinians have been killed and injured. The region has faced extensive destruction and reports of starvation.

Furthermore, international legal bodies are scrutinizing Israel's actions, with arrest warrants issued for key Israeli officials by the International Criminal Court and a genocide case underway at the International Court of Justice.
